Address 160.28934986 DCR

DsZ8FNrpaLx6SjNL7tNrRFH21T3m2Lg7EsK

Confirmed

Total Received160.28934986 DCR
Total Sent0 DCR
Final Balance160.28934986 DCR
No. Transactions1

Transactions